Description
Use info-center console channel to specify the console output channel. The system uses this channel to
output information to the console.
Use undo info-center console channel to restore the default console output channel.
By default, the console output channel is channel 0.
The info-center console channel command takes effect only when the information center has been
enabled with the info-center enable command.
Examples
# Specify the console output channel as channel 0.
<Sysname> system-view
[Sysname] info-center console channel 0
info-center enable
Syntax
info-center enable
undo info-center enable
View
System view
Default level
2: System level
Parameters
None
Description
Use info-center enable to enable the information center.
Use undo info-center enable to disable the information center.
The switch can output system information only after the information center is enabled.
By default, the information center is enabled.
Examples
# Enable the information center.
<Sysname> system-view
[Sysname] info-center enable
Info: Information center is enabled.
